Room tariffs

Recap from last time

1) European plan: Room only rate.2) Continental plan: Room rate and

continental breakfast.3) American plan: Room rent and all meals

(i.e., breakfast, lunch and dinner).4) Modified American Plan: Room rent +

Breakfast + One major meal.5) Bed & breakfast or Bermuda plan: Room

rate and American breakfast.

Types of rates

The standard rate of a particular type of room before any discount is called rack rate.

Rack rate

These are offered to companies, which give us frequent business.

These rates are not be revealed to other guests.

These rates are generally 10-20% less than the rack rate.

Corporate rate

These rates are used in many hotels where supply and demand of rooms varies daily.

We know it as Oberoi special rate.

Demand based rate or rate of the day

Travel agents sell travel products like hotel rooms, airline tickets etc.

Many travel agents have special contracted rates with hotels.

These rates are confidential and must not be reavealed to anyone. That means if the travel agent is paying the rate must not be printed on the registration form or the bill presented to the guest.

Travel agent rate
